The total number of residential property sales in Macao dropped 18.1% year-on-year, which shows a “significant” contraction.
A total of 2,542 building units and parking spaces were purchased and sold in the third quarter as per stamp duty records, a decrease of 3.6 per cent quarter-to-quarter.
Macao’s overall residential property price index for May-July rose by 1.0% over the previous period (April-June) to 268.8.
The number of residential and commercial property sales plunged in the first half of the year amid the ongoing coronavirus-induced economic recession. According to real estate experts, the situation today is similar to 2014, when the property market was reeling from a sharp contraction in gross gaming revenue.
